How Do Different Designs Affect Winch Noise Levels?
Different designs can significantly impact the noise levels produced by a winch during operation.
- Gear Design: The type of gears used in a winch, such as planetary or worm gears, can influence noise levels. Planetary gears tend to operate more quietly due to their smooth engagement and better load distribution, while worm gears can produce more noise due to friction and the nature of their design.
- Motor Type: The motor’s design, whether it’s a brushed or brushless motor, affects the noise generated. Brushless motors are generally quieter and more efficient, producing less mechanical noise compared to traditional brushed motors, which can create additional noise from the brushes making contact with the commutator.
- Housing Material: The material used for the winch housing can dampen noise. Steel housings may amplify sounds, while aluminum or composite materials can absorb vibrations, resulting in a quieter operation.
- Mounting Design: How a winch is mounted can also affect noise levels. A winch that is bolted securely to a solid surface will produce less vibration and noise compared to one that is loosely mounted or installed on a less rigid structure, which can resonate and amplify sound.
- Lubrication: The type and quality of lubrication used in the winch’s moving parts play a critical role in noise reduction. Proper lubrication minimizes friction and wear, leading to smoother operation and reduced noise levels, whereas inadequate lubrication can result in increased friction and louder operation.

How Can You Choose the Right Quiet Smooth Winch for Your Needs?
Choosing the right quiet smooth winch involves considering various factors tailored to your specific needs.
- Load Capacity: It’s crucial to select a winch that can handle the weight of the items you’ll be lifting or pulling. Assess the maximum load capacity required for your tasks to ensure safety and efficiency.
- Power Source: Winches can be powered by electricity, hydraulics, or manual operation. Consider your available power sources and choose a winch that fits your operating environment, whether it’s a vehicle-mounted, portable, or stationary unit.
- Noise Level: Since you’re looking for a quiet winch, check the manufacturer’s specifications for noise ratings. A winch designed for quiet operation often features advanced motor technology and sound-dampening materials to minimize noise during use.
- Speed of Operation: The speed at which a winch operates is essential, especially for tasks that require quick lifting or pulling. Look for models that offer variable speed settings to provide better control over your operations.
- Durability and Weather Resistance: Consider the materials and construction of the winch to ensure it can withstand harsh conditions, especially if it will be used outdoors. Look for winches with corrosion-resistant finishes and robust housing to enhance longevity.
- Ease of Installation: Some winches come with complex installation processes, while others are designed for straightforward setup. Evaluate the installation requirements of the winch and choose one that fits your skill level and available tools.
- Brand Reputation and Warranty: Research brands that are known for producing high-quality winches and check customer reviews for user experiences. A good warranty can also provide peace of mind, indicating the manufacturer’s confidence in their product.
